ZnO nanopowder has been successfully synthesized by a microwave-assisted solution approach using Zn(CH 3 CO 2 ) 2 β€’2H 2 O and NaOH. The results obtained from X-ray diffraction (XRD), scanning electron microscopy (SEM) and transition electron microscope (TEM) show that the mean particle size is 30 nm
